Art Nouveau - Similar in some respects to Art Deco, this classic sweeping style arrived in the late 19th century and just preceded Art Deco, with subtle curves and lines, which often includes birds, flowers, animals and other natural items. At the time of Art Nouveau, jewellers began to move away from diamonds, using rubies, sapphires and emeralds, which introduced rich colours. Paris was the centre of attraction with Art Nouveau, with fine jewellery makers such as Louis Aucoc, who worked with his father and brother in their family business.
